Avenue Bistro Pub is a modern take on the traditional bistro scene, with both a bustling bar and sit down option, customers can enjoy good food and good drinks. The menu at Avenue features classic American dishes such as burgers and steaks and also includes more exotic options such as smoked salmon, chicken satay, and its famous short ribs. Enjoy outdoor seating when the weather is good.

Had a lovely dinner at Avenue Bistro the other night. I ordered the brie with orange marmalade to start. What a great comfort food! For my entree, had the Thai tuna special which was out of this world. The sauce was a sweet and spicy balance with pineapple and peanuts, and the tuna was perfectly cooked rare. My friend and I shared a bottle of their house chard. I'm not usually a chard drinker but their house chard was very good. Even though we were full, we couldn't pass up the cinnamon creme brulee for dessert. Great meal, good music, nice ambience - loved it and will definitely go back again with friends and family.
